strings is a great Linux tool. You run it and it burps up all of the coherent strings of text in a file. Even ran it against the new iTunes and found:

rental-content

rental-bag

rbsync

source-rental-info

dest-rental-info

Which seems to suggest some sort of video rental stuff coming up soon. It could also suggest some sort of vestigial functionality from iTunes 1.1 when Steve, during a Shamanistic hot lodge ritual, was offered a vision of a version of iTunes that could burn DVDs and then the iPods could fly out and destroy the DVDs after a certain period. Perhaps the world will never know.
